    Hotel Edison was in a very prime location. It was approximately 30 steps to Times Square and close to many other tourist destinations in NYC. The room was very clean and comfortable, but was small and very dated. The bathroom was even smaller. The bathroom was so small that I could use the bathroom and brush my teeth at the same time. Hotel Edison is a good place to rest your head for a few hours before heading out and exploring the city. I went with the best and cheapest deal on Expedia when booking this room. I would stay there again, because of the location and the money saved. However, if there was a better deal at a different hotel, I would give it a try because you can get to any location in NYC by the subway, which only cost $2.50 to ride.

    Don't tell too many people about this fantastic hotel right in the middle of it all!! Sure, it's old - you can tell by the plumbing in the bath - but it's clean. The lobby is nice - designed by the same architect as Radio City Music Hall - it is elegant with it's beautiful marble and magnificient chandeliers. But the very best part is that you can literally walk out the front or the back doors of the hotel and walk straight across the street into several theatres. It is 1/2 block from the tickets booth and just 1 1/2 blocks from Lindy's and Joe's Steakhouse. It is reasonably priced by New York city standards. Spent a few days there in July and thoroughly enjoyed the accommodations and the friendly and helpful staff.
